I sent him this:
Do you have a Dyno sheet for the claimed HP numbers? And, are these numbers at the crank or at the rear wheel?
It is very difficult to get even 80 HP out of a CR500, even with porting, high compression, reeds, pipe, silencer, modern carb and modern ignition. So your numbers are impressive, if in fact these are from a known good Dyno.
We'll see what he says!
